An individual originating from the acclaimed animated film series centered on toys that come to life when humans are not present. These personalities exhibit a range of traits, motivations, and relationships, driving the narrative and resonating with audiences of all ages. Woody, a pull-string cowboy doll, and Buzz Lightyear, a space ranger action figure, are prime examples, illustrating the diverse nature of these fictional beings.

These figures’ significance lies in their ability to explore universal themes of friendship, loyalty, and self-discovery. The narratives built around them provide valuable lessons about acceptance, change, and the importance of embracing one’s identity. From a historical perspective, the introduction of these characters marked a turning point in animation, showcasing the potential of computer-generated imagery to create compelling and emotionally resonant storytelling.

Frequently Asked Questions About Individuals from the Toy Story Universe

The following addresses common inquiries regarding the personalities featured in the acclaimed animated franchise. The intent is to provide factual and concise answers.

Question 1: What defines a personality within the Toy Story universe?

A defining factor is the character’s sentience and ability to experience emotions, form relationships, and act independently, despite being inanimate objects. Their defining personalities come from experiences with their owner and others.

Question 2: Are there consistent character archetypes within the film series?

Yes, archetypes such as the loyal leader, the insecure newcomer, and the supportive friend are recurring themes. However, the series subverts expectations and offers layered character development.

Question 3: How does a character’s origin (e.g., a mass-produced toy vs. a handmade item) impact its development?

A character’s origin often influences its initial perception of self-worth and purpose. Mass-produced items might struggle with identity, while handmade items may grapple with the uniqueness of their existence.

Question 4: What role do villains play in the overall narrative?

Antagonists serve to challenge the protagonists’ values and force them to confront their own flaws and prejudices. They often represent themes of abandonment, obsolescence, or control.

Question 5: Is character death a consistent element within the series?

While the characters are inanimate, moments of perceived “death” or permanent separation are used to explore themes of loss, acceptance, and the cyclical nature of life.

Question 6: How does the series address the topic of a character becoming obsolete or unwanted?

The series confronts the fear of being replaced by newer, more desirable items. It emphasizes the importance of finding new purpose and value, even in the face of change.
